以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  [求助]数据拆分统计  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=163311)

--  作者:lgj716330
--  发布时间:2021/4/23 9:03:00
--  [求助]数据拆分统计

图片点击可在新窗口打开查看此主题相关图片如下:qq图片20210423090042.png
图片点击可在新窗口打开查看
如图,左边是源数据,如何将左边的数据分别统计成右边的结果

--  作者:有点蓝
--  发布时间:2021/4/23 9:11:00
--  
dim nr as row
for each r as row in tables("表A").rows
for each s as string in r("姓名").split(",")
nr =  tables("表B").addnew
dim sr() as string = s.split("(")
nr("姓名") = sr(0)
nr("编号") = r("编号") 
nr("占比") = sr(1).replace(")","")
next
next

对表B做个分组统计即可得到方式二